After being cancelled last year due to the Coronavirus pandemic, the Son Day in the Park event will return to Clymer.
The 16th edition of the event will take place the weekend of July 31st and August 1st in Sherman Street Park in Clymer. On the 31st will be the opening service from 5-8 PM with communion, prayer requests, anointing, food and music with Brad and Lannie. The main day of the festival is Sunday, from 2-8 PM. Along with a food court and activities for kids, there will be music at the main pavilion all day from Frazier and Friends, Sherri Danae, Finding the Lost, A&R Music and Giving Grace. The guest speaker for the festival will be Christian Author Cheryl Marie.
The event is free and open to the public.
